Carmichael Reappointed as an OAH Distinguished Lecturer

CWI Director Pete Carmichael has been reappointed to the Organization of American Historians’ Distinguished Lectureship Program. Functioning as a speakers bureau dedicated to American history, the Distinguished Lectureship Program is a reliable and easy-to-use resource for identifying and contacting leading historians who can share their expertise with audiences. Lecturers give one lecture per academic year for three years, donating the honorarium received to the OAH. Founded in 1907, the Organization of American Historians (OAH) is the largest professional society dedicated to the teaching and study of American history. The mission of the organization is to promote excellence in the scholarship, teaching, and presentation of American history, and to encourage wide discussion of historical questions and the equitable treatment of all practitioners of history.
